Output 59ebcb7fa84101be0abad33b3c837f24722de080b30ee1232ad8aa72af6e2836:3

value
378153
script pubkey
OP_0 OP_PUSHBYTES_20 630b589189bdf0f9f7864974ba2c84258759b9c8
address
bc1qvv943yvfhhc0nauxf96t5tyyykr4nwwgtfgq2h
transaction
59ebcb7fa84101be0abad33b3c837f24722de080b30ee1232ad8aa72af6e2836
spent
true